What Are Zebra Direct Thermal Labels?
These labels are produced through a direct thermal process that relies on heat instead of ink cartridges or toner. Printing occurs when the heat-sensitive layer passes through the printer's thermal printhead.
These labels are frequently selected for logistics operations, retail receipts, and stock management systems. Checking printer compatibility before use is recommended to ensure reliable performance and print quality.

Common Questions About Zebra Direct Thermal Labels
What are Zebra direct thermal labels typically used for?
Many organisations use them for stock management, dispatch operations, and product identification.
Do direct thermal labels require ribbons, toner, or ink?
No. Direct thermal labels print through heat-sensitive technology and do not require ink, toner, or ribbon cartridges.
What is the expected lifespan of these labels?
Durability depends on storage conditions, handling, and environmental exposure. Direct thermal labels are best suited to applications where long-term permanence is not essential.
Can Zebra printers accommodate multiple label formats?
Yes. Various label sizes can often be used within the same printer model.
Are direct thermal labels waterproof?
Basic paper labels provide limited protection against prolonged moisture exposure. However, synthetic alternatives are available where greater durability is required.
Which industries commonly use Zebra-compatible labels?
Businesses operating in stock management, manufacturing, food processing, and healthcare frequently rely on Zebra labelling solutions.
What causes direct thermal labels to fade?
Thermal images may fade if subjected to excessive heat, abrasion, or ultraviolet light.
